Responsibilities
Promotes and sells consumer and business deposit products by interviewing customers to determine their needs.
Upon receipt of deposit application, proceeds with appropriate product procedure, completing necessary paperwork to ensure that customers’ deposit needs are met in a courteous, timely manner.
Actively participates in bank sales promotions and activities, contributing to the achievement of bank established goals.
Refers business loans, mortgage loans, and investment prospects to the appropriate sales representative within the bank.
Participates in business development activities such as officer call programs, community organizations and special events sponsored by the bank.
Maintains teller cash drawer to assist customers when necessary. Follows cash handling and balancing guidelines as specified in the Retail Operations Manual.
Monitors cash shipment orders through the Federal Reserve Bank and the delivery of cash through American Security Corporation.
Reviews daily overdraft report, makes decisions based on bank policy and procedure prior to 10:00 a.m.
Performs quarterly audit of Travelers Cheques as well as monthly audits of the teller cash drawer and the vault.
Assists Teller with weekly balancing of the ATM.
Provides backup teller support as needed to include processing transactions, answering phones, balancing the vault, assisting customers, etc.
Performs other duties as assigned.
Requirements
Bachelor’s degree (B.A.) from four-year college or university; or two to three years related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
